I am using notepad++ v4.0.2 with explorer plugin v1.2 beta 1 in Windows Vista, and when I try to browse network drives the program frequently freezes. I can browse the drives fine in Windows; it's not a connection problem to the file server. Any ideas? Is there a workaround for this?
If you would like to refer to this comment somewhere else in this project, copy and paste the following link:
It's a known issue and will be fixed asap. The problem: I didn't create a seperate thread for updating the drives and folders ;). I will anounce the new Beta version when it's done.
